Using Virtual Reality with Cardio Equipment for Immersive Training
In recent years, the integration of virtual reality (VR) with cardio equipment has transformed the landscape of fitness training. This innovative approach offers users an immersive experience that enhances motivation and engagement while exercising. Traditional cardio workouts can often feel monotonous; however, implementing VR technology addresses this issue by providing thrilling, interactive environments that captivate users throughout their routine. With virtual reality headsets, users are transported into immersive landscapes, making them feel as if they are cycling through a picturesque mountain range or running on a serene beach. As they train within these stimulating environments, users can focus better and enjoy their workouts much more. Moreover, the promise of competition, such as racing against friends in a virtual setting or overcoming challenges, further increases user enjoyment. This blend of physical training and virtual experiences can lead to more consistent exercise habits and ultimately improved cardiovascular health. Challenges and Considerations
Despite the numerous advantages VR provides in cardiovascular training, various challenges must be addressed to ensure its effective implementation. For instance, equipment can be costly, making it inaccessible for many users who may benefit from immersive training. Individuals looking to engage in VR cardio workouts must assess the affordability and practicality of such technology as a long-term investment. Additionally, there are concerns regarding the potential for motion sickness while using VR headsets, which some users may experience during intense physical activity. Developers must continuously advance their technology to mitigate these issues, striving for a more comfortable and enjoyable experience for all users. Furthermore, proper training and education on VR technology are essential to facilitate user understanding of equipment utilization and best practices for optimal physical performance. Not only will this ensure safety, but it will also greatly enhance user satisfaction and long-term commitment to integrating VR into their exercise regimens. The ongoing evolution of VR in fitness demands collaboration between technology experts and fitness professionals to create innovative, safe solutions tailored to user needs.
